AI Summary
-
Declares nondisclosure and confidentiality provisions void and unenforceable when they prohibit disclosure of child sexual abuse acts or related facts to third parties
-
Covers provisions in any type of agreement, including employment agreements, settlement agreements, and standalone confidentiality agreements
-
Defines "act of sexual abuse" to include indecency with a child, sexual assault, aggravated sexual assault, sexual performance by a child, trafficking of persons, and compelling prostitution under Texas Penal Code
-
Preserves the ability of parties to keep confidential the financial amounts and terms of settlement agreements
-
Applies retroactively to agreements entered into before, on, or after the effective date of September 1, 2025
Legislative Description
Relating to the enforceability of certain nondisclosure or confidentiality provisions with respect to an act of sexual abuse committed against a child.
